Acid Reflux without Nexium

Controlling acid reflux without Nexium can be tough. Nexium belongs to the drug class of proton pump inhibitors that cure acid reflux problems by actually reducing the production of acid inside the stomach. The reduced acid thereby leads to less chances of reflux to the food pipe and hence permits healing of the esophagus.

Pregnant women however, have to do without Nexium. In clinical circumstances, where no other alternative medication is suitable, lower doses of Nexium can be given. Alternatively, women who get pregnant while administering Nexium should inform their doctors about it.

While we are talking of acid reflux without Nexium, an important concern though can be side effects that are caused by this medication. These side effects include headache, diarrhea, and abdominal pain. These conditions may vanish after a few days but if they prolong, then one needs to consult the physician.

Nexium is available in form of delayed release capsules and delayed release oral suspension. In case of people who have difficulties swallowing the capsule, the contents of the capsule can be emptied and dissolved in applesauce. The granules should not be chewed. In case of oral suspension, the packet should be emptied and mixed with water. It is then allowed to thicken before consumption. If you are planning to control acid reflux without Nexium, then you can have antacids and other medications but these may only treat symptoms of heartburn without actually healing the damaged esophagus.
